In a grand return to the spirits scene, Penelope Bourbon announces the much-anticipated re-release of its illustrious Rio edition, a limited-edition straight Bourbon whiskey that promises to encapsulate the vibrant spirit of Brazil within its very essence.
Dubbed by enthusiasts as a "carnival in a bottle," Penelope Rio is poised to grace shelves once again this March, promising enthusiasts an unrivaled sensory experience reminiscent of the colorful festivities of Rio de Janeiro. This year's installment, however, carries with it an air of exclusivity, with only a select allocation of 5,000 cases available to the discerning palates eager to embark on this flavorful journey.
Crafted under the meticulous guidance of Penelope Bourbon's founder and master blender, Daniel Polise, Rio stands as a testament to the brand's unwavering commitment to quality and innovation. With a double cask finish that marries the robust flavors of American honey and the exotic allure of Amburana, a Brazilian hardwood, this bourbon beckons connoisseurs to indulge in its tantalizing depths.
Drawing inspiration from the infectious joy of Brazil, Rio unveils a symphony of flavors that dance upon the palate with each sip. From the initial aroma of sweet honey intertwined with tantalizing notes of freshly baked cinnamon rolls to the rich body adorned with hints of gingerbread, honey, and nectar, every element of this bourbon contributes to a harmonious sensory experience. Yet, it is in the savory finish, punctuated by subtle nuances of honey and spice, where Rio's true brilliance shines through, leaving an indelible impression on the discerning palate.
Bottled at a robust 98 proof, Rio's blended four-grain mash bill, comprising 74% corn, 16% wheat, 7% rye, and 3% malted barley, serves as the foundation upon which its unparalleled complexity is built. About Penelope Whiskey
Penelope Bourbon is a relatively new player in the American whiskey scene, founded in 2018 by three childhood friends with a shared passion for whiskey. Based in New York City, Penelope Bourbon is named after one of the founder's grandmothers, reflecting the brand's commitment to heritage, tradition, and family values. Despite its short time in the market, Penelope Bourbon has quickly gained attention for its high-quality spirits and innovative approach to whiskey-making.
One of Penelope Bourbon's distinguishing features is its unique blending process, which involves marrying small batches of bourbon from different distilleries to create a final product with a balanced and complex flavor profile. The distillery carefully selects barrels from various sources, including Kentucky and Tennessee, to achieve the desired characteristics and ensure consistency in each bottle of Penelope Bourbon.
Penelope Bourbon offers a range of expressions, including its flagship Penelope Four Grain Bourbon, which is crafted from a blend of corn, wheat, rye, and malted barley. This bourbon is aged in new charred oak barrels and boasts a smooth and mellow flavor profile, with notes of caramel, vanilla, and spice. Penelope Bourbon also releases limited-edition and special bottlings, allowing enthusiasts to explore new and unique expressions.
